
Blink-182 bassist Mark Hoppus confirmed that the band is currently writing new music, but also said that it will likely be another year before new material is released. Speaking to NME Hoppus said:
"We're going to tour Australia in February with Blink... [so the] proper tour and the new album probably won't happen for about a year."
The shows in Australia are significant because of drummer Travis Barker's fear of flying. It was originally believed that Barker would not join the band for their Australia dates. But, a concert promoter confirmed that Barker would join the band in Australia. Barker has not riden in an airplane since he was involved in a plane crash back in 2008. He played European dates with the band after riding a boat across the Atlantic Ocean.
